What Is Commercial Real Estate?

Before we dive into tips on finding commercial real estate near me, it’s worth clarifying what we mean by “commercial real estate.”

Commercial real estate (CRE) includes properties used for business purposes, such as:

  • Office buildings
  • Retail centers or shops
  • Warehouses and industrial properties
  • Multi-family apartment buildings (sometimes classified as commercial)
  • Special-purpose properties like hotels or medical offices

Unlike residential real estate, CRE is usually evaluated based on income potential and business viability, not just square footage or location aesthetics.

Financing Commercial Real Estate

One of the biggest hurdles for first-time investors or small business owners is financing. Unlike residential mortgages, commercial loans often require:

  • Higher down payments
  • Detailed financial statements
  • Strong credit history

You may also encounter specialized loan programs depending on property type, such as SBA loans for certain businesses. Knowing your options and preparing your financial documents can make the process smoother.

Common Mistakes to Avoid

Even experienced investors make mistakes when searching for commercial real estate near me. Watch out for:

  1. Ignoring Location Dynamics: Location isn’t just convenience; it’s a long-term investment factor.
  2. Skipping Inspections: Unseen structural issues can turn a good deal into a nightmare.
  3. Overestimating Rental Income: Always be conservative with income projections.
  4. Not Considering Future Development: Local plans and regulations can impact your property value.
